3.0 out of 5 stars A Philosopher who truly understands relativity, July 13, 2004
Bertrand Russel was an excellent writer, and one of the few philosophers who truly understood relativity. This book is also a classic. However, the book attempts to explain relativity to the layman using "text" only. The book is not mathematical, and it contains very few graphs or diagrams. This is not the best approach to explaining relativity. Good graphs/diagrams/images can to a certain extent replace equations. There are many modern introductory books and multimedia presentations that does a better at job at introducing relativity.

I recommend this book as a "classic", but not as an introduction to relativity for the non-physicist.

3.0 out of 5 stars ABZ of Relativity, April 9, 2006
By 
Cevat Cokol (New York, NY, United States) - See all my reviews
I think this book can justifiably be called ABZ of relativity. The author sincerely tries to tell us about relativity by building up from basic elements, but at the point it gets to the stuff that is supposed be really interesting, it becomes unintelligible for the less gifted. He gives three pages to tell us about the difference between mass and weight, but the central concept of "interval" is used for some pages before being poorly defined and explained. I am positively sure he understands relativity and all, and I am sure those definitions are correct in the strictest sense, however they didn't help a beginner, at least in this case. Having said this though, this book is still a very nice read and could be read even if only for its strange humor and wisecracks.

2.0 out of 5 stars Considerable disappointment, July 25, 2011
This review is from: Bertrand Russell Bundle: ABC of Relativity (Routledge Classics) (Paperback)
Bertrand Russell

ABC of Relativity

Routledge Classics, Paperback, 2009.
8vo. xvii, 150 pp. Preface by Felix Pirani, 2002 [vi]. Introduction by Peter Clark, 1997 [vii-xvii]. Edited by Felix Pirani, 1985.

First published, 1925.
First published in Routledge Classics, 2009.

Contents

Introduction
1. Touch and Sight: The Earth and the Heavens
2. What Happens and What is Observed
3. The Velocity of Light
4. Clocks and Foot-rules
5. Space-Time
6. The Special Theory of Relativity
7. Intervals in Space-Time
8. Einstein's Law of Gravitation
9. Proofs of Einstein's Law of Gravitation
10. Mass, Momentum, Energy, and Action
11. The Expanding Universe
12. Conventions and Natural Laws
13. The Abolition of 'Force'
14. What is Matter?
15. Philosophical Consequences

Notwithstanding the greatest admiration I have for the author, "The ABC of Relativity" has been my first disappointment with Bertrand Russell; perhaps not a major one, but a disappointment nonetheless. Despite that his style is as lucid as ever and every sentence makes a perfect sense, the overall effect I did find quite unsatisfactory indeed. It is still quite a mystery to me what is so great about the theory of relativity; perhaps its greatness is relative. Lord Russell's book is almost entirely devoid of mathematical horrors and was of course written especially for the lay reader, it is quite readable and does have several interesting points which might just convince me that the theory of relativity is not totally useless for me, but on the whole I remain a sceptic about its ultimate value outside the very restricted world of astrophysics. Sometimes, indeed, Lord Russell comes tantalisingly close to make some real sense of terms like space-time or their kinky intervals, but he never really ventures into the realm of the comprehensible. The matter remains thoroughly transcendental as far as I am concerned.

Interestingly, the book contains a very short preface by one Felix Pirani who apparently revised it no fewer than three times to include new scientific developments.The first two of these revisions were carried out with the approval of Bertrand Russell, the fourth happened 15 years after his death and was a sole responsibility of Mr Pirani. He also mentions that most revisions occupied the chapter about the expanding of the universe, whereas the purely philosophical content of the last two chapters was the reason why he didn't touch them at all. At any rate, Mr Pirani's revisions seems to have been minor and he can hardly be held responsible for any problems one might have with the book; indeed, most of his revisions are either too minor or too subtle to be noticed at all. 3.0 out of 5 stars Sometimes the analogies miss the mark, November 6, 2009
The theories of relativity developed by Albert Einstein are contrary to what we experience in daily life and a complete understanding requires knowledge of high-level mathematics. Therefore, in the years after the theories first appeared in print, few people had a complete understanding of what the theories were. However, presented using the proper analogies, it is possible for the layperson to understand a great deal of the principles of relativity.
This book is the attempt by British mathematician/philosopher Bertrand Russell to explain relativity to the masses. While the result is generally successful, the analogies are sometimes weak and more puzzling than revealing. If you are interested in explanations of science and relativity for the layperson, then my suggestion is that you read the popular science writings of Isaac Asimov instead. No one is better than Asimov at making science understandable and Russell lacks some of the necessary literary genes for expository writing.
